Jersey City Jehovah's Witnesses Reach Out To Indian Americans
by Bangalore injersey city jehovah's witnesses reach out to indian americans.. http://www.nj.com/hudson/index.ssf/2015/05/jersey_city_jehovahs_witnesses_reach_out_to_indian.html.
on a recent sunday morning, isaac mata, a boston-based indian american software-engineer, drove some 200 miles to jersey city, not for a family or business get-together, but to participate in the jehovah's witnesses' biannual circuit-level convention for people of indian origin.. inside the jw assembly hall in the historic old stanley theater building at journal square on april 19, mata along with his wife, kalyani, a medical doctor, sat in one of the second-floor side auditoriums with their two small children listening to the daylong proceedings that focused on seeking peace and pursuing it in family and social life.. the couple -- both of whom are from hyderabad, india, and born to hindu parents -- faithfully held copies of the bible in hindi in their hands like all others present throughout the six-hour-long convention.
on the podium were two people one reading from the bible and the other translating the gospel in chaste hindi.. "it was such a wonderful experience, and so enlightening for all of us," mata said afterward.
